In 2019-2020, 14,318 people earned their degree in biochemistry, biophysics and molecular biology, making the major the 68th most popular in the United States. In 2017-2018, biochemistry, biophysics and molecular biology graduates who were awarded their degree in 2015-2017, earned an average of $33,860 and had an average of $22,130 in loans still to pay off.

Across Ohio, there were 485 biochemistry, biophysics and molecular biology graduates with average earnings and debt of $29,900 and $22,142 respectively.

  • The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System (IPEDS) from the National Center for Education Statistics (NCES), a branch of the U.S. Department of Education (DOE) serves as the core of our data about colleges.
  • Some other college data, including much of the graduate earnings data, comes from the U.S. Department of Education’s (College Scorecard).
  • Information about the national average student loan default rate is from the U.S. Department of Education and refers to data about the 2016 borrower cohort tracking period for which the cohort default rate (CDR) was 10.1%.
